1. What is Dynamic Bankroll Management?

At its core, dynamic bankroll management refers to the ongoing practice of adjusting financial strategies based on income, expenses, and financial goals. Unlike static management, where budgeting remains the same regardless of changes in life, dynamic management adapts to shifts in circumstances.

This approach ensures you can handle unexpected expenses while still building toward long-term financial success. Whether you’re dealing with a salary increase, a new business opportunity, or a sudden economic downturn, your bankroll strategy shifts to accommodate these changes, keeping your finances in check.

Critical Aspects of Dynamic Bankroll Management:

  • Adaptability: Your financial plan adjusts based on changing circumstances.
  • Focus on Growth: As your income grows, so does your investment in wealth-building activities.
  • Risk Management: Ensures you are prepared for financial emergencies.

2. Master Budgeting: The Foundation of Financial Independence

Budgeting is the bedrock of any sound personal finance strategy. In Kenya, where the cost of living continues to rise, managing every shilling wisely is essential. A well-crafted budget allocates your income to crucial needs, discretionary spending, and savings.

Budgeting Tips:

  • Track your spending: Use mobile apps like M-Pesa or banking apps to monitor every transaction.
  • Allocate percentages: Aim for a 50/30/20 rule: Spend 50% of income on needs, 30% on wants, and 20% on savings or investments.
  • Set financial goals: Whether buying land, starting a business, or saving for retirement, have a clear purpose for your savings.

By setting a budget and sticking to it, you’ll always have control over your finances and a roadmap toward financial independence.

3. Emergency Fund: Your Financial Safety Net

Building an emergency fund is one of the core principles of dynamic bankroll management. Life is unpredictable, and unexpected events—such as medical emergencies, car breakdowns, or job losses—can severely impact your financial stability.

In Kenya, where many households live, pay cheque to pay cheque, having a well-funded emergency account is crucial. Aim to save at least 3-6 months’ living expenses in a high-yield savings account.

Why an Emergency Fund is Essential:

  • Protects against debt: Without savings, unexpected costs can lead to high-interest loans or the use of expensive mobile lending platforms.
  • Provides peace of mind: Knowing you’re financially prepared for emergencies reduces stress and promotes long-term financial health.

4. Invest in Sustainable Wealth Growth

Saving alone is not enough to increase your wealth. To achieve financial independence, you need to invest. Your money should be working for you, whether it’s stocks, bonds, real estate, or local business ventures.

Opportunities for investment are growing in Kenya. You can build wealth sustainably and securely by investing in government bonds or SACCOs (Savings and Credit Cooperative Organizations). Additionally, consider investing in real estate or agriculture, sectors that have shown significant growth in recent years.

Investment Options in Kenya:

  • Treasury Bonds: Secure, long-term investments backed by the government.
  • SACCOs: Offer better returns on savings and access to affordable loans.
  • Real Estate: Kenya’s growing urban centers provide ample opportunities for property investment.
  • Chama Groups: A traditional yet effective form of group savings and investment.

By consistently investing in assets that grow over time, you’ll develop a passive income stream, ensuring you never run out of money.

5. Smart Financial Planning for Long-Term Success

Intelligent financial planning involves creating a roadmap for your short-term and long-term financial goals. This includes saving for big purchases like a home, education for your children, or even early retirement.

In Kenya, there are several tools and resources to help plan your financial future:

  • Pension schemes: Contribute to retirement plans such as NSSF or private pension funds.
  • Life insurance: Protect your loved ones by investing in insurance policies offering coverage and savings.
  • Estate planning: Create a will to ensure your assets are distributed according to your wishes.

Tips for Long-term Success:

  • Automate savings: Set up standing orders with your bank to automatically transfer money into your savings or investment account.
  • Reassess regularly: As your income grows, reassess your financial plan to ensure it meets your evolving needs.
  • Diversify your investments: For better security, don’t put all your money in one place. Spread it across different assets.

6. Money-Saving Tips for Everyday Life

Saving money can sometimes mean making significant sacrifices. However, small, innovative changes in one’s everyday life can lead to substantial savings.

Practical Money-Saving Tips:

  • Use public transport: Instead of driving, save on fuel by using Matatus or BRT (Bus Rapid Transit) in Nairobi.
  • Buy in bulk: Shop at local markets and buy food or household items in bulk to save money.
  • Leverage deals and discounts: Use mobile apps and online platforms to get the best prices for essential goods and services.
  • Energy conservation: Save electricity by switching off unused appliances and using energy-saving bulbs.

Adopting these small habits can help you save more and build long-term wealth.
